Biography of Viggo Mortensen
Full Name | Viggo Peter Mortensen Jr. |
---|---|
Date of Birth | October 20, 1958 |
Place of Birth | New York City, New York, USA |
Occupation | Actor, Producer, Director, Poet, Photographer |
Years Active | 1985 - Present |
Awards | Academy Awards, BAFTA, Screen Actors Guild Awards |
Early Life
Viggo Mortensen was born to a Danish father and an American mother, which gave him a rich cultural background. He spent his childhood in various places, including Argentina, where he became fluent in Spanish. This multicultural upbringing profoundly influenced his worldview and artistic expression.
Growing up, Mortensen developed a passion for the arts, particularly literature and painting. He attended St. Lawrence University, where he studied Spanish and politics, further enhancing his appreciation for different cultures.
Career Beginnings
Mortensen's acting career began in the late 1980s, where he appeared in various theater productions and television shows. His early work laid the foundation for his later success, showcasing his talent and dedication to the craft.
His breakthrough came with the film "The Indian Runner" (1991), directed by Sean Penn. This marked the beginning of a fruitful collaboration with independent filmmakers, setting the stage for Mortensen's future roles in critically acclaimed films.
Breakthrough Role
Viggo Mortensen achieved international fame for his role as Aragorn in the "The Lord of the Rings" trilogy (2001-2003). His portrayal of the reluctant hero resonated with audiences and solidified his status as a leading actor in Hollywood.
This iconic role not only showcased his acting skills but also his physicality and dedication to the character, as he underwent extensive training for the demanding action sequences. Mortensen's performance earned him a nomination for the Screen Actors Guild Award, further establishing him as a prominent figure in the film industry.
Notable Films
Throughout his career, Mortensen has starred in a diverse range of films that highlight his versatility as an actor. Some of his notable works include:
- A History of Violence (2005) - A gripping thriller that examines the dark side of a seemingly perfect life.
- Eastern Promises (2007) - A critically acclaimed crime drama that explores the world of the Russian mafia in London.
- Captain Fantastic (2016) - A thought-provoking film that challenges societal norms through the lens of an unconventional family.
- Green Book (2018) - A heartwarming film that tells the true story of an unlikely friendship between a working-class Italian-American and a classical pianist.
